隐式类型转换1.  isNaN()判断数据类型是不是NaN返回值为boolean,执行过程中是将数据放到number方法中isNaN('123');  // 结果:false2.  ++     --       +、-(一元正负运算符)var a = 10;  console.log(-a);  //结果:-10;console.log(++a);  //结果:11;3.  + 字符串拼接 调用
JS
转载 2021-05-19 10:30:19
204阅读
2评论
JSON的格式:对象由键值对构成,键和值都要用引号引起来数据由逗号分隔花括号保存对象方括号保存数组JSON是JS对象或数组的字符串表示法var obj ={"name":"hello","age":18}; //这是一个JS对象var obj = '{"name":"hello","age":18}'; //这是一个JSON字符串,本质是字符串JS对象和J...
原创 2022-02-11 17:48:55
340阅读
activeIndex为字符串 :active="activeIndex - 0" ...
转载 2021-09-01 15:22:00
88阅读
====Class(类) Js中,生成实例对象的传统方法是通过构造函数 function Point(x, y) { this.x = x; this.y = y; } var p = new Point(1, 2); 上面这种写法跟传统的面向对象语言(比如 C++ 和 Java)差异很大 ES6 提供了更接近传统语言的写法,引入了 Class(类)这个概念,作为对象的模板。通过cla
##类型转换 由于JAVA 是强类型语言, 所以要进行有些运算的时候,需要用到类型转换 低 高 byte,short, char->int->long->float->double 类型转换需要注意问题 不能对布尔值进行类型转换 不能把对象类型转换为不相干的类型 在把高容量转换到低容量的时候,强制转 ...
转载 2021-09-23 10:59:00
261阅读
2评论
类型转换 int i = 128; byte b = (byte)i;//内存溢出 //强制转化类型)变量名 高--低 //自动转换 低--高 System.out.println(i); System.out.println(b); 注意: 不能对布尔值进行转换 不能把对象类型住转换为不相干的 ...
转载 2021-09-17 12:13:00
78阅读
2评论
强制类型转换:强制类型转换代码实现以及注释2、强制类型转换图示讲解
一、数据类型 JS中的简单数据类型可以分为五种:Number 、String 、Boolean、Undefined 、Null。Number:数字类型 ,整型浮点型都包括;String:字符串类型,右数字字母字符串以及标点符号组成,必须放在单引号或者双引号中;Boolean:布尔类型,只有true和false两种值;Undefined:未定义,一般指的是已经声明,但是没有赋值的变量,如v
注意任何对象都有toString()方法吗?null和undefined就没有!另外,null还伪装成了object类型。 number对象调用toString()报SyntaxError问题:123.toString(); // SyntaxError遇到这种情况,要特殊处理一下:123..toString(); // '123',
原创 2021-06-29 14:34:03
402阅读
​​Number​​​:整数或浮点数,还有一些特殊值(​​-Infinity​​​、​​+Infinity​​​、​​NaN​​ 注意任何对象都有​​toString()​​方法吗?​​null​​和​​undefined​​就没有!另外,​​null​​还伪装成了​​object​​类型。​​number​​对象调用​​toString()​​报​​SyntaxError​​问题:123.to
原创 2022-02-17 11:00:34
325阅读
在Firefox,chrome,opera,safari,ie9,ie8等浏览器直接可以用JSON对象的stringify()和parse()方法。1、JSON.stringify(obj)将JS对象转为JSON字符串。 //JS对象 var obj={"name":"tom","sex":"男","age":"24"}; //JS对象转化为JSON字符串 var jsonString = JS
ECMAScript中将数据类型分为三类:基本数据类型,特殊数据类型和复合(引用)数据类型一、基本数据类型String:字符串数据类型,放在单引号或者双引号中Number:数字类型,包括int和float两种Boolean: 布尔类型,只有true和false两种值二、特殊数据类型undefined:变量声明后但未赋值,其值便为undefined,如:var a;还有一种情况:var a
转载 2024-01-12 07:06:06
71阅读
Boolean的所有类型->布尔类型为假1.整形02.浮点型0.03.字符串""4.null5.NaN6.undefined
js
原创 2017-10-24 20:31:16
1065阅读
JS中数据类型的转换什么是数据类型的转换? 就是把一个数据类型转换成一个其他的数据类型。 一:其它数据类型转换成 数值Number() 语法:Number(你要转换的变量) 返回值:能转换的就是数字,不能转换的就是 NaN 注意:把要转换的内容当成一个整体,能转换的就是数字,不能转换的就是 NaN ,认识小数点,还有就是需要稍微注意下 Number 它的首字母需要大写,不要写成了number。 举
文章目录JS-6种数据类型以及转换1. 基本数据类型String 字符串Number 数值Boolean 布尔值Null 空值Undefined 未定义2. 引用数据类型Object 对象3. 类型转换3.1 转换为String3.2 转换为Number3.3 其他的进制的数字3.4 转换为布尔值4. 总结-思维导图 尚硅谷JavaScript高级教程(javascript实战进阶)个人认为Ja
转载 2023-09-28 09:45:39
97阅读
hive类型转化Hive的原子数据类型是可以进行隐式转换的,类似于Java的类型转换,例如某表达式使用INT类型,TINYINT会自动转换为INT类
原创 2023-02-01 09:48:24
227阅读
什么是JSON?就是一种数据格式;比如说,我们现在规定,有一个txt文本文件,用来存放一个班级的成绩;然后呢,我们规定,这个文本文件里的学生成绩的格式,是第一行,就是一行列头(姓名 班级 年级 科目 成绩),接下来,每一行就是一个学生的成绩。那么,这个文本文件内的这种信息存放的格式,其实就是一种数据格式。学生 班级 年级 科目 成绩 张三 一班 大一 高数 90 李四 二班 大一 高数 80ok
类型之间的转换问题    1.同种数据类型之间是可以直接进行赋值操作         例如:        int a = 1;int b = a;   float x = 3.4;float y = x;    2.数据类型不同的空间 之间的赋值---&gt
原创 2023-05-17 20:52:52
160阅读
在 JavaScript 中,类型转换分为 显式转换(Explicit Coercion) 和 隐式转换(Implicit Coercion),而“强制转换”通常指开发者主动触发的显式转换。理解它们的规则对避免 Bug 至关重要。1. 显式转换(主动强制转换)开发者 明确调用方法或操作符 进行类型转换。常见方式:构造函数转换:String(123); // "123"(数字转字符串)
js把其他类型转化成字符串 一、总结 一句话总结:类型转换中的强制类型转换分为类型转换函数和类型名强制。js后一种和其它语言不同,是类型类的构造方法。String() 二、js把其他类型转化成字符串 toString() : 除了null和undefined之外,其他的类型(数值,布尔,字符串,对象
转载 2018-06-15 23:54:00
133阅读
2评论
  • 1
  • 2
  • 3
  • 4
  • 5